WebbAs you journey south through the Panhandle, head for Lubbock, the “Hub City” of the region. It’s a straight shot down the wide-open Interstate 27 highway. This musical mecca was home to the legendary Buddy Holly and now features the Buddy Holly Center —part museum, part performing arts venue. The hot season lasts for 3.6 months, from May 27 to September 15, with an average daily high temperature above 83°F. The hottest month of the year in Panhandle is July, with an average high of 91°F and low of 68°F. The cold season lasts for 2.9 months, from November 24 to February 21, with an average daily ...

WebbDISTRIBUTION: The White-faced Ibis is an uncommon to common resident along the Texas coast; and, is a rare and localized breeder inland as far north as the Panhandle (Lockwood and Freeman 2004). It is limited by the 100th meridian to the east, the 36°30′ parallel to the north, and the 103rd meridian to the west.
